5.1.6 Corrections and Filters

The last page of the sidescan
processing wizard is for correcting
position and gain loss in the mosaic.

Process Navigation

This section selects the
correct navigation to use for
creating the mosaic, with
three options available:

o

Process Navigation

- If

processing is needed and
has not been done, then the top option allows the user to set the navigation
processing parameters.

o

Use Processed Navigation -

If processing has already been done, then this

option tells the processing algorithm to look in the cache for the navigation
values to use.

o

Use Raw Navigation (from XTF) - This option is for data where the navigation
does not need to be processed and the values in the XTF files are good to use
for creating the mosaic. Generally this is only true for navigation processed
externally from Perspective and then inserted into the XTF file after it was
processed using scripts in MatLab or using another application.

Grid Corrections

If there is an existing DTM of the survey area, the topography can be used to
correct the mosaic in two ways:

o

Topography:

Applies 'position' corrections by using the changes in elevation

in the DTM.

o

Angle of Incidence:

Applies 'amplitude intensity' corrections by accounting

for the angle of incidence between the sidescan beam and the seafloor (still
is development!).
